ORDER

WILLIAM B. SHUBB, District Judge.

On March 14, 2012, defendant Bao Hoang Lu filed a motion to vacate, set aside, or correct his sentence pursuant to 28 U.S.C. § 2255. The United States shall file its opposition to defendant's motion no later than May 21, 2012. Defendant may then file a reply no later than June 11, 2012. The court will then take the motion under submission.
